FTKEE emerges as Champion of UMPSA Inter-Faculty Games (SukFAC) 2024

GAMBANG, 24 November 2024 – The Faculty of Electrical and Electronic Technology Engineering (FTKEE), Universiti Malaysia Pahang Al-Sultan Abdullah (UMPSA), made history by clinching the overall championship title for the first time at the Inter-Faculty Games (SukFAC) 2024.

FTKEE secured victory with four gold medals in the Men’s Team Chess, Men’s Team Tenpin Bowling, Men’s Team Field Bowling, and Women’s Volleyball events.

UMPSA showcases research innovations and forges collaborations at the Putrajaya Festival of Ideas (FOI)

PUTRAJAYA, 29 November 2024 – Universiti Malaysia Pahang Al-Sultan Abdullah (UMPSA) participated in the inaugural Putrajaya Festival of Ideas (FOI), held from 27 to 29 November 2024 at the Putrajaya International Convention Centre (PICC).

Organised by the Ministry of Higher Education (KPT) in collaboration with the Putrajaya Corporation, the two-day festival provided a platform to share ideas, thoughts, research, and innovations with the public.

UMPSA receives courtesy visit from Proton, Geely, and AHTV Alliance delegation

PEKAN, 21 November 2024 – Universiti Malaysia Pahang Al-Sultan Abdullah (UMPSA) recently welcomed a courtesy visit from delegations representing Proton, Geely Holding Group, and the AHTV Alliance.

The event, held at the Banquet Hall, Tun Abdul Razak Chancellery, included an industry lecture session aimed at strengthening ties between higher education institutions and the automotive industry.

WORQ provides Start-Up Office space for the benefit of UMPSA staff

KUALA LUMPUR, 21 November 2024 – Co-working spaces, or shared workspaces, are becoming increasingly popular and rapidly expanding as an alternative to conventional offices. 
These spaces differ from traditional offices by offering a more flexible work culture and diverse facilities.

The Innovation and Commercial Management Centre (ICC), Research and Innovation Department (JPI), in collaboration with UMPSA Advanced, now has office space at WORQ Sunway Putra Mall, operational since 1 June 2024.

UMPSA Chemical and Waste Safety Management Seminar attracts over 70 Laboratory Assistants and Teachers in Pahang

KUANTAN, 9 November 2024 – The Chemical and Waste Safety Management Seminar, organised by the Faculty of Industrial Sciences and Technology (FSTI) at Universiti Malaysia Pahang Al-Sultan Abdullah (UMPSA), recently attracted over 70 participants, including laboratory assistants and teachers from various schools across Pahang, such as Kuantan, Temerloh, Kuala Lipis, Rompin, and other districts.
